head 1.6; access; symbols pkgsrc-2026Q2:1.6.0.14 pkgsrc-2026Q2-base:1.6 pkgsrc-2026Q1:1.6.0.12 pkgsrc-2026Q1-base:1.6 pkgsrc-2025Q4:1.6.0.10 pkgsrc-2025Q4-base:1.6 pkgsrc-2025Q3:1.6.0.8 pkgsrc-2025Q3-base:1.6 pkgsrc-2025Q2:1.6.0.6 pkgsrc-2025Q2-base:1.6 pkgsrc-2025Q1:1.6.0.4 pkgsrc-2025Q1-base:1.6 pkgsrc-2024Q4:1.6.0.2 pkgsrc-2024Q4-base:1.6 pkgsrc-2024Q3:1.5.0.14 pkgsrc-2024Q3-base:1.5 pkgsrc-2024Q2:1.5.0.12 pkgsrc-2024Q2-base:1.5 pkgsrc-2024Q1:1.5.0.10 pkgsrc-2024Q1-base:1.5 pkgsrc-2023Q4:1.5.0.8 pkgsrc-2023Q4-base:1.5 pkgsrc-2023Q3:1.5.0.6 pkgsrc-2023Q3-base:1.5 pkgsrc-2023Q2:1.5.0.4 pkgsrc-2023Q2-base:1.5 pkgsrc-2023Q1:1.5.0.2 pkgsrc-2023Q1-base:1.5 pkgsrc-2022Q4:1.4.0.8 pkgsrc-2022Q4-base:1.4 pkgsrc-2022Q3:1.4.0.6 pkgsrc-2022Q3-base:1.4 pkgsrc-2022Q2:1.4.0.4 pkgsrc-2022Q2-base:1.4 pkgsrc-2022Q1:1.4.0.2 pkgsrc-2022Q1-base:1.4 pkgsrc-2021Q4:1.3.0.2 pkgsrc-2021Q4-base:1.3 pkgsrc-2021Q3:1.2.0.6 pkgsrc-2021Q3-base:1.2 pkgsrc-2021Q2:1.2.0.4 pkgsrc-2021Q2-base:1.2 pkgsrc-2021Q1:1.2.0.2 pkgsrc-2021Q1-base:1.2 pkgsrc-2020Q4:1.1.0.4 pkgsrc-2020Q4-base:1.1 pkgsrc-2020Q3:1.1.0.2 pkgsrc-2020Q3-base:1.1; locks; strict; comment @# @; 1.6 date 2024.10.11.22.38.32; author bacon; state Exp; branches; next 1.5; commitid 80KZIqc54ZnYpitF; 1.5 date 2023.02.25.13.52.39; author bacon; state Exp; branches; next 1.4; commitid S1ER2JHjc6noBUeE; 1.4 date 2022.02.26.23.11.43; author bacon; state Exp; branches; next 1.3; commitid vBtXjoGGAIbsobuD; 1.3 date 2021.12.17.15.10.06; author bacon; state Exp; branches; next 1.2; commitid ZLdbEZtaduAK01lD; 1.2 date 2021.03.20.18.17.07; author bacon; state Exp; branches; next 1.1; commitid xHhEvARbUkdBL4MC; 1.1 date 2020.07.26.23.30.30; author bacon; state Exp; branches; next ; commitid RWPoxV3qUPCp8EhC; desc @@ 1.6 log @biology/samtools: Update to 1.21 Numerous bug fixes and enhancements since 1.17 Changes: https://github.com/samtools/samtools/releases Reported by: portscout @ text @$NetBSD$ # Respect pkgsrc env --- Makefile.orig 2021-03-19 17:48:34.572594186 +0000 +++ Makefile @@@@ -61,12 +61,11 @@@@ misc_bindir = $(bindir) MKDIR_P = mkdir -p INSTALL = install -p -INSTALL_DATA = $(INSTALL) -m 644 -INSTALL_DIR = $(MKDIR_P) -m 755 -INSTALL_MAN = $(INSTALL_DATA) -INSTALL_PROGRAM = $(INSTALL) -INSTALL_SCRIPT = $(INSTALL_PROGRAM) - +INSTALL_DATA = ${BSD_INSTALL_DATA} +INSTALL_DIR = $(MKDIR_P) +INSTALL_MAN = ${BSD_INSTALL_MAN} +INSTALL_PROGRAM = ${BSD_INSTALL_PROGRAM} +INSTALL_SCRIPT = ${BSD_INSTALL_SCRIPT} PROGRAMS = samtools @ 1.5 log @biology/samtools: Update to 1.17 Numerous enhancements and bug fixes Changes: https://github.com/samtools/samtools/releases @ text @@ 1.4 log @biology/samtools: Update to 1.15 Several minor enhancements and bug fixes Changes: https://github.com/samtools/samtools/tags @ text @@ 1.3 log @biology/samtools: Update to 1.14 Numerous fixes and enhancements since 1.12 Changes: https://github.com/samtools/samtools/tags @ text @@ 1.2 log @biology/htslib: Update to 1.12 biology/bcftools: Update to 1.12 biology/samtools: Update to 1.12 Numerous enhancements, performance improvements, and bug fixes since 1.10 Minimized pkgsrc patches in all three packages Moved htslib to custom tarball since Github-generated distfiles are incomplete @ text @@ 1.1 log @biology/samtools: Upgrade to 1.10 Numerous performance and feature improvements and several bug fixes since 1.9 @ text @d5 1 a5 1 --- Makefile.orig 2020-07-21 20:20:56.996788479 +0000 d7 1 a7 34 @@@@ -21,12 +21,12 @@@@ # F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ER # DEALINGS IN THE SOFTWARE. -CC = gcc -AR = ar -CPPFLAGS = +CC ?= gcc +AR ?= ar +# CPPFLAGS = #CFLAGS = -g -Wall -O2 -pedantic -std=c99 -D_XOPEN_SOURCE=600 -CFLAGS = -g -Wall -O2 -LDFLAGS = +CFLAGS ?= -g -Wall -O2 +#LDFLAGS = LIBS = LZ4DIR = ./lz4 @@@@ -47,10 +47,10 @@@@ AOBJS= bam_index.o bam_plcmd.o sam_ bam_quickcheck.o bam_addrprg.o bam_markdup.o tmp_file.o LZ4OBJS = $(LZ4DIR)/lz4.o -prefix = /usr/local -exec_prefix = $(prefix) +PREFIX ?= /usr/local +exec_prefix = $(PREFIX) bindir = $(exec_prefix)/bin -datarootdir = $(prefix)/share +datarootdir = $(PREFIX)/share mandir = $(datarootdir)/man man1dir = $(mandir)/man1 @@@@ -58,12 +58,11 @@@@ man1dir = $(mandir)/man1 misc_bindir = $(bindir) d10 1 a10 1 -INSTALL = install -p d16 1 d23 1 a24 1 PROGRAMS = samtools @